Both are pretty good brands. The only springs i'd actually stay away from would be the #1 springs on Cobalt Addiction and the Tenzos. #1 is a cheapo brand that Nopi owns.....my friend used to have them on his '03 Civic EX when he had it.......eventually switched to ST springs. The #1 springs rode absolutely horrible. As for the Tenzo springs.......Tenzo is focused on designing seats, exhausts, intakes, engine dress up, wheels, tachs.....etc etc.....so they aren't exactly focused on designing a nice spring for any certain car. The Tenzo springs tend to oversettle and ride rough.

Goldline is a good brand......kinda faded out a bit over the past.......but nontheless, still reputable.

K-Sport is an up and coming name. They currently have a few drift cars, time attack cars, and road race cars, so racing roots is never a bad platform to build a name upon. So i'd say K-Sport is pretty good stuff too.
